I can explain about the Total Recall Special Edition.

A few years ago, Lionsgate released their special editions in those limited collector cases - Basic Instinct came in the clear plastic case with the icepick pen, and Total Recall came in a round tin with a "sponge" that kept the disc from being scratched. These titles were both remastered in HD at that time.

So all they did for the Blu-ray release was take a print from that "Special Edition" HD master. So that is why its called the Special Edition - that they used the SE master instead of the previous master - not because of any extras.

It's not really double dipping when the market is as small as it is on either format. If they're doing their releases again from launch with better understanding of the format and codecs as well as space, in the long run it's better to let those relatively small production runs from the summer peter out and let these take over. Providing they actually are new encodes.
